commit | e93ec6f9d8dd122557d54505129f7860b9301503 | [log] [tgz] |
---|---|---|
author | Junio C Hamano <junkio@cox.net> | Wed Jan 18 20:26:14 2006 -0800 |
committer | Junio C Hamano <junkio@cox.net> | Thu Jan 19 18:29:11 2006 -0800 |
tree | d09a24007dad4963163049402b29519209b051a5 | |
parent | ee3d299e93450586d12f099913261ec22849365a [diff] |
Revert "check_packed_git_idx(): check integrity of the idx file itself." This reverts c5ced64578a82b9d172aceb2f67c6fb9e639f6d9 commit. It turns out that doing this check every time we map the idx file is quite expensive. A corrupt idx file is caught by git-fsck-objects, so this check is not strictly necessary. In one unscientific test, 0.99.9m spent 10 seconds usertime for the same task 1.1.3 takes 37 seconds usertime. Reverting this gives us the performance of 0.99.9 back.